1344614561 has 2 divisors, whose sum is σ = 1344614562. Its totient is φ = 1344614560.
The previous prime is 1344614549. The next prime is 1344614563. The reversal of 1344614561 is 1654164431.
It is a strong prime.
It can be written as a sum of positive squares in only one way, i.e., 1335463936 + 9150625 = 36544^2 + 3025^2 .
It is an emirp because it is prime and its reverse (1654164431) is a distict prime.
It is a cyclic number.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 1344614561 - 230 = 270872737 is a prime.
Together with 1344614563, it forms a pair of twin primes.
It is a Chen prime.
It is not a weakly prime, because it can be changed into another prime (1344614563)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written as a sum of consecutive naturals, namely, 672307280 + 672307281.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(672307281).
